The station is equipped to cater to various passenger needs with its different facilities and services. The ticket office at New Brighton operates with extensive opening hours, from 5:38 am to 12:28 am on weekdays and 7:38 am to 12:28 am on Sundays. For those who prefer modern conveniences, tickets can be collected from the ticket office, even if purchased online, with accessible ticket machines available for all passengers. Smartcards are a practical option at this station, where both issuance and validation are supported.
Passengers can feel secure with the presence of CCTV monitoring across the station. While there are no luggage storage options, the station compensates with friendly staff help available during operating hours and customer help points. Although New Brighton lacks ticket barriers, the station accommodates all with its Category A step-free access, ensuring smooth navigation to the platforms and ticket office.
Hungry travelers will appreciate the presence of a café and vending machines for both cold drinks and snacks, but note that there are no cash machines or shops on-site. For those ready to pedal their way through the area, bicycle storage is available with sheltered and CCTV-secured stands. Unfortunately, there are no cycle hire facilities, but you can easily use your bicycle once at your destination.
New Brighton's connectivity is further complemented by its integration with other transport modes. Although no taxi rank exists directly at the station, onward travel is facilitated by local bus services. The nearest airport, Liverpool John Lennon Airport, can be conveniently reached by purchasing a combined rail/bus ticket at any Merseyrail station. This will allow you to catch buses 86A or 80A from Liverpool South Parkway, taking just ten minutes to reach the airport.

One of the key aspects of Totnes Train Station is its user-friendliness, ensuring that your journey starts off on the right foot. The station is equipped with a ticket office, operational from early morning until late, from Monday through Sunday. For those purchasing tickets online, collection is quite simple with accessible ticket machines conveniently located at the station entrance.
When it comes to accessibility, Totnes station shines. It is classified as a Category A station, signifying step-free access throughout, including both platforms via a liftbridge. Wheelchair users will find more accessible options at Totnes such as ramps and designated parking spaces. CCTV surveillance adds a layer of security to both platforms.
For customer assistance, help points and meeting points are widely available, with staff on hand to assist from early morning until the late evening. Travelers looking to be informed and updated on their routes can rely on clear announcements and departure screens placed across the station.
Totnes station offers several conveniences that can make your visit much more comfortable. Enjoy a quick bite or relax with a hot drink at the café located on Platform 2, enabling you to enjoy a moment of relaxation before you continue your journey. Although you won't find public Wi-Fi or ATMs on the premises, the town center isn't far off and has ample facilities.
Travelers can easily transition from rail to road with a taxi rank located adjacent to Platform 1. Whether you're continuing your journey by bus or need a touchpoint for international flights, Totnes offers straightforward options. Plan onward bus journeys using a printable guide, directing you to various local points of interest or international flights through key transfer hubs like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ick.
Though bicycle hire is not directly available at the station, there are options in the surrounding areas, making it an excellent spot for cycling enthusiasts wanting to explore the Devon landscape at their leisure.
